Output e0c5c8294468538b113ba6993955339df202dcee29f0dd5b79311e2daa3c57eb:10

value
26131494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30491af81b8b6c79d2ffd57173d3a7031d3280e3 OP_EQUAL
address
366KwCZwaMST18bfnUc3DPGR3Hbzx3peeh
transaction
e0c5c8294468538b113ba6993955339df202dcee29f0dd5b79311e2daa3c57eb
spent
true